Hi! My name is Joy. I live in Katy Texas with my husband John our 15 month old son Harry and my 2 wonderful furkids Holly (5 years) and Pinto (about 9 years). I work at a Pet resort called Rover Oaks so I am lucky that Holly and Pinto can come with me to work most days. Holly we got as a puppy from a breeder she has been the love of my life since I first saw her. She is very much a mommy's girl. When Holly was 1 we started doing volunteer work with WRNT. We have had many fosters all of whom I love deeply. We adopted Max in September of 2005, he was 10 years old we lost him to bloat in January of 2006. I was devastated and still to this day get emotionally when I think about it. Shortly after he passed we got a call to see if we could foster Pinto for just 1 week because there were people in our area who wanted him. Well here we are 2 years later and I couldn't imagine our home without him. He was super skinny when we got him, you could see every rib and vertebra in his body. He was also beat up pretty bad he lost a fight with a glass door weeks before he came to us so his foot was all bandaged up and the night before they brought him to us another dog beat him up. He decided he liked us and we were his family anytime people would see him he would ignore them or there dog or would bark and not stop time and time again no one wanted him and he was very vertebrae with himself! We finally decided to keep him and made his adoption official on August 1 2006. He is about 9 now and did not even know how to play when we got him. He loves to play now!
Both Holly & Pinto are Canine Good Citizens and I am hoping to train Pinto to be a therapy dog after the first of the year and Holly soon after.
